×

ubound

ubound(vba中lbound和ubound)

admin admin 发表于2023-08-17 14:20:16 浏览57 评论0

抢沙发发表评论

本文目录一览:

vb中ubound怎么用

1、LBound 函数: 返回一个 Long 型数据,其值为指定数组维可用的最小下标。语法为LBound(arrayname[, dimension])UBound 函数: 返回一个 Long 型数据,其值为指定的数组维可用的最大下标。

2、ReDim Preserve a(UBound(a) + 1) 至此数组元素有102个 (若不需保留原有数组信息,去掉Preserve关键字即可。

3、VB中的Ubound和LBound是用来获取指定数组维可用的最大和最小下标值。UBound 函数,返回一个 Long 型数据,其值为指定的数组维可用的最大下标。UBound 函数示例 该示例使用 UBound 函数,确定数组的指定维的最大可用下标。-ubound

4、b = UBound(arr, 2) 第二个参数=2,表示取数组的横向有多少个值,b=2 在VB中,注释有2种方式。以Rem关键字开头,并且Rem关键字与注释内容之间要加一个空格。注释可以是单独的一行,也可以写在其他语句行的后面。-ubound

5、中用 To 子句来设定维数的数组而言,Private、Public、ReDim 或 Static 语句可以用任何整数作为下界。=== UBound 函数:返回一个 Long 型数据,其值为指定的数组维可用的最大下标。-ubound

6、格式:UBound(数组名[,维])功能:LBound函数返回一个数组中指定维的下界。uBound函数返回一个数组中指定维的上界。说明:(1)格式中的[,维]是指定要测试的数组的某一维。两个函数一起使用,即可确定一个数组的大小。-ubound

vb语言中Ubound(a)是什么意思?

a是数组,ubound是取数组下标上界的函数,还有另外一个相关函数lbound,是取数组下标下界的函数。

VB中 lbound(a) 是什么意思 获取阵列a的最小下标值,比如 a(1 To 10),则LBound(a)的值就是1 VB中LBound是什么意思? LBound 函式 返回一个 Long 型资料,其值为指定阵列维可用的最小下标。-ubound

Option Base 1这句定义数组从1开始 因此a(3)=3+3-1=5 最后结果为5 UBound(a)为a数组的上标,由于下表从1开始,数组中有5个元素,因此UBound(a)=5。

vb里的lbound和ubound的用法

1、Dim AnyArray(10)Upper = UBound(MyArray, 1) 返回 10。Upper = UBound(MyArray, 3) 返回 20。Upper = UBound(AnyArray) 返回 10。-ubound

2、LBound 函数与 UBound 函数一起使用,用来确定一个数组的大小。UBound 用来确定数组某一维的上界。

3、lbound是下标,ubound是上标。取顶取底要看你的需要。

VBA中的UBound

LBound 函数: 返回一个 Long 型数据,其值为指定数组维可用的最小下标。语法为LBound(arrayname[, dimension])UBound 函数: 返回一个 Long 型数据,其值为指定的数组维可用的最大下标。-ubound

UBound(arrayname[, dimension])arrayname 必需的。数组变量的名称,遵循标准变量命名约定。dimension 可选的;Variant (Long)。指定返回哪一维的上界。1 表示第一维,2 表示第二维,如此等等。-ubound

UBound(hr),是数组的上边界,第一个元素标号默认为0,这里hr有4个元素,所以UBound(hr)=3 两个For 语句嵌套使用,循环获取取指定范围内的所有单元格内的值,并依次追加到应付账款表格内。-ubound

c是一个数组 b(j)是b数组的一个元素,filter这里的意思就是从c数组中找出包括b(j)的所有元素,构成一个新的数组。vba.filter(c,b(j))这里的意思就是从c中找出包含b(j)的所有元素构成一个新的数组。-ubound

你对UBound函数的理解没错。问题在于数组A的结构只是你自己主观想象。你在VBA编辑器中,选择视图→本地窗口,然后按F8逐行测试代码,自然可以在本地窗口中看到数组A的结构。这样不就一目了然了,知道问题在哪儿了吗。-ubound

VBA中“UBound”是什么意思?

1、表示第二维,如此等等。如果省略 dimension,就认为是 1。

2、计算它的长度就是 Ubound(a) + 1,Ubound()函数是用来获取数组中最大上限。例如某数组有5个元回素,那么,通过个取得的最大上限就是4,因为vb中的数组是从0开始的,所以在取得这个最大上限之答后还需要加上一个1。-ubound

3、vba.filter(c,b(j))这里的意思就是从c中找出包含b(j)的所有元素构成一个新的数组。再说ubound(参数)这个函数的作物,这里的参数必须是一个数组,而函数的返回值是这个参数数组的最大下标。-ubound

4、假设我们都不知道自己选了多少文件,但是F知道。

5、最小、最大下标对应可以理解为下标的下限和上限吧,分别用函数Lbound(Array),Rbound(Array)可以获得。VBA应该也是相类似的吧。至于上标……VB、vba里好像没听说过。数学公式或者其他的专业术语中也许有这个名称吧。-ubound

6、UBound(hr),是数组的上边界,第一个元素标号默认为0,这里hr有4个元素,所以UBound(hr)=3 两个For 语句嵌套使用,循环获取取指定范围内的所有单元格内的值,并依次追加到应付账款表格内。-ubound